Hourly Schedule

The State Theatre - Sunday, November 5th

5:30pm - 6:30pm
Cocktail Reception
Hosted and sponsored by Seven Mountains Wine Cellars, Chef Freddie Bitsoie and Brown Dog Catering.
6:30pm - End
Festival Awards Ceremony
This year’s ceremony, emceed by Jason Browne and Cynthia Mazzant, will include Jury Awards for films in competition, our Lifetime Achievement Award and the Chandler Living Legacy Award.

About The Film

Twenty-five long years after his time in the limelight, former child actor Cody Lightning tries to revive his fortunes with a self-produced sequel to Smoke Signals in this smart, irreverent new comedy.

From Oct. 30 – Nov. 5, 2023, The Centre Film Festival will return for a weekend of the finest offerings in contemporary cinema at the State Theatre in State College and the Rowland Theatre in Philipsburg.

We are back to celebrate the magic of storytelling on the big screen and beyond. Join us in honoring multigenerational narratives and sparking meaningful conversations through art, locally and globally. With the historic Rowland Theatre and State Theatre as our backdrop, we’re getting all set to bring you more than 50 Pennsylvania Premieres, 4 United States Premieres, Made in PA films, a night of Thrills and Chills for Halloween, Sports on Screen, World Cinema, Pride on Screen, and an inaugural Indigenous Peoples Heritage Month track… and so much more.
